课程简介

慕课网前端高手特训 从0到1带你手写一个微信小程序底层框架

构建一个全面的产品设计能力框架,是成为优秀产品经理的关键。本课程旨在帮助你解锁各种实用工具的应用,并掌握实操技巧,从而在多维度上塑造你的通用产品设计思维。这将为你顺利进入产品经理行业奠定坚实的基础,并使你能够通过提升产品能力来增加工作效率和效果。在本课程中将引导你从架构设计、原理分析到源码实现,逐步深入地构建一个完整的微信小程序底层框架。通过这一系列的实战训练,你将深入理解小程序的双线程机制,提升你的技术实力,增加获得理想工作机会的可能性,从而成为一名真正具备实力的技术专家。

相关课程

从0到1落地微前端架构, MicroApp实战招聘网站

课程目录

.
├── 第1章 课程简介/
│   ├── [ 22K] 1-1课程演示demo地址.pdf
│   └── [ 37M] 1-2导学
├── 第2章 双线程简易模型:对双线程有一个初步认识/
│   ├── [9.2M] 2-1小程序框架技术方案概述
│   ├── [ 64M] 2-2webview的使用
│   ├── [ 23M] 2-3jscore的使用
│   ├── [ 22M] 2-4iframe的使用
│   ├── [ 14M] 2-5webworker的使用
│   └── [ 21M] 2-6简易双线程示例
├── 第3章 微信客户端开发:双线程模型运行的基石/
│   ├── [9.8M] 3-1客户端模拟项目搭建
│   ├── [ 16M] 3-2ios设备模拟
│   ├── [ 68M] 3-3微信应用模拟
│   └── [ 63M] 3-4小程序容器初始化
├── 第4章 小程序应用初始化/
│   ├── [ 68M] 4-1小程序应用初始化
│   └── [ 14M] 4-2通信桥bridge创建
├── 第5章 逻辑线程建设:JS代码运行环境/
│   ├── [ 22M] 5-1逻辑线程初始化
│   └── [ 53M] 5-2逻辑线程的通信通道建设
├── 第6章 渲染线程建设:wxml代码运行环境/
│   ├── [ 65M] 6-1渲染线程初始化
│   └── [ 58M] 6-2渲染线程的通信通道建设
├── 第7章 应用资源加载/
│   ├── [ 50M] 7-1小程序资源加载
│   ├── [ 25M] 7-2逻辑线程注册信息的存储
│   └── [ 17M] 7-3渲染线程注册信息存储
├── 第8章 app实例的创建于生命周期函数调用/
│   ├── [ 23M] 8-1创建app实例
│   └── [ 59M] 8-2app生命周期调用
├── 第9章 页面首次渲染过程/
│   ├── [ 29M] 9-1构建initialData
│   ├── 由乐学编程网lexuecode.com
│   ├── [ 12M] 9-2initialData分发
│   ├── [ 17M] 9-3wxml转render函数
│   └── [ 31M] 9-4页面首次渲染firstRender
├── 第10章 page实例的创建于生命周期函数调用/
│   ├── [ 36M] 10-1创建page实例
│   └── [ 49M] 10-2page生命周期调用
├── 第11章 事件机制与视图更新setData的实现/
│   ├── [ 39M] 11-1事件机制的实现
│   └── [ 26M] 11-2视图更新setData的实现
├── 第12章 构建编译命令行工具:编译出微信开放平台提审产物/
│   ├── [ 15M] 12-1命令行设计
│   ├── [ 40M] 12-2配置文件编译
│   ├── [ 37M] 12-3wxml的编译-1
│   ├── [ 41M] 12-4wxml的编译-2
│   ├── [ 90M] 12-5js的编译
│   ├── [ 32M] 12-6wxss的编译
│   └── [ 54M] 12-7编译产物消费
├── 第13章 小程序路由管理:多个webview的调度与生命周期实现/
│   ├── [ 52M] 13-1页面跳转navigationTo
│   └── [ 34M] 13-2页面返回navigationBack
├── 第14章 内置组件开发:更丰富的内置组件,为编写抖音小程序做准备/
│   ├── [ 22M] 14-1条件渲染模板语法的实现
│   ├── [ 22M] 14-2列表渲染模板语法的实现
│   ├── [ 43M] 14-3内联样式的实现
│   ├── [ 38M] 14-4异步回调函数的实现
│   ├── [ 25M] 14-5打开小程序navigateToMiniProgram
│   ├── [ 29M] 14-6封装text内置组件
│   ├── [9.7M] 14-7封装image内置组件
│   ├── [ 33M] 14-8wx.showToast的实现
│   ├── [ 38M] 14-9封装swiper内置组件
│   ├── [ 26M] 14-10事件参数的实现
│   └── [ 65M] 14-11封装video内置组件
├── 第15章 抖音小程序实现:运行在我们自己搭建小程序框架之上/
│   ├── [ 77M] 15-1开发抖音小程序1
│   ├── [ 73M] 15-2开发抖音小程序2
│   └── [4.4M] 15-3课程总结
└── 第16章 框架细节优化/
├── [ 52M] 16-1事件传参的语法优化
├── [ 16M] 16-2setData性能优化
└── [ 30M] 16-3wxml编译优化
└── 资料代码/

2024-3-10:已更新完结,百度云盘下载。

发表回复

登录... 后才能评论